Larry Young is also a well-known sculptor who has placed over 50 monumental outdoor sculptures nationally and abroad. Most of his work has been in bronze, but he also works with stainless steel, marble, and other materials. He owns and operates a full-scale, 6000 square feet (557.4 m²) foundry where he personally creates and produces most of his work.http://columbiatribune.com/2007/aug/20070828news018.asp, http://columbiatribune.com/2007/feb/20070209feat001.asp

Larry and his wife Candy Young reside in Columbia, MO.
